aboutsummaryrefslogtreecommitdiffstatshomepage
path: root/tunnel (follow)
Commit message (Expand)AuthorAgeFilesLines
* libwg-go: use PeekLookAtSocketFd6(), not PeekLookAtSocketFd4()Jonathan Davies2020-09-161-1/+1
* tunnel: document more public API from backend packageHarsh Shandilya2020-09-166-1/+174
* Ed25519: use implementation from TinkJason A. Donenfeld2020-09-164-23/+2513
* wireguard-tools: bump to fix invalid freeJason A. Donenfeld2020-09-151-0/+0
* libwg-go: update to go 1.15.2Jason A. Donenfeld2020-09-153-21/+21
* gradle: desugar retrofuture and remove old depsJason A. Donenfeld2020-09-156-21/+11
* tools: bump for Android 11 ndc fixHarsh Shandilya2020-08-261-0/+0
* build: target SDK 30Harsh Shandilya2020-08-251-2/+2
* build: remove explicit buildToolsVersionHarsh Shandilya2020-08-231-1/+0
* libwg-go: use conn.Bind for socketfd peekDavid Crawshaw2020-06-223-9/+19
* tools: bump versionsJason A. Donenfeld2020-06-075-20/+21
* tunnel: add windows-style killswitch semantics for GoBackendJason A. Donenfeld2020-05-041-1/+12
* libwg-go: bump go versionHarsh Shandilya2020-04-261-3/+3
* ToolsInstaller: update Magisk directoryHarsh Shandilya2020-04-231-6/+6
* tunnel: disable LongLogTag lintHarsh Shandilya2020-04-191-0/+3
* tunnel: disable BuildConfig generationHarsh Shandilya2020-04-081-0/+3
* tunnel: support IncludedApplications as whitelistJason A. Donenfeld2020-04-054-0/+42
* tunnel: hold peers in an ArrayListHarsh Shandilya2020-04-061-3/+1
* version: bump1.0.20200401Jason A. Donenfeld2020-04-031-0/+0
* tunnel: libwg-go: use deterministic verdef nameJason A. Donenfeld2020-04-031-1/+1
* tunnel: libwg-go: remove -x option from flockJason A. Donenfeld2020-04-011-2/+2
* global: cleanup code styleJason A. Donenfeld2020-03-306-18/+27
* tunnel: libwg-go: check sha256 of downloaded tarballJason A. Donenfeld2020-03-291-1/+5
* tunnel: libwg-go: stick go tarball in gradle cacheJason A. Donenfeld2020-03-293-7/+18
* tunnel: libwg-go: prevent parallel downloadsJason A. Donenfeld2020-03-291-3/+5
* tunnel: fix package name being passed through to cmakeJason A. Donenfeld2020-03-291-0/+16
* global: hardcode tags so that minification doesn't ruin the logJason A. Donenfeld2020-03-285-5/+5
* libwg-go: update go modulesJason A. Donenfeld2020-03-222-13/+13
* libwg-go: bump go versionJason A. Donenfeld2020-03-221-1/+1
* InetEndpoint: return proper parser exceptionJason A. Donenfeld2020-03-191-1/+1
* publish.gradle: Use non-deprecated API to prevent eager configuration of tasksHarsh Shandilya2020-03-141-2/+2
* tunnel: Add an initial set of unit testsHarsh Shandilya2020-03-1413-0/+308
* tunnel: Remove MISSING_VALUE from BadConfigException reasonsHarsh Shandilya2020-03-141-1/+0
* config: show missing section error correctlyJason A. Donenfeld2020-03-131-1/+3
* tunnel: replace CompletableFuture with GhettoCompletableFutureJason A. Donenfeld2020-03-122-3/+33
* tunnel: we return Optional types so mark retrostreams as apiJason A. Donenfeld2020-03-121-1/+1
* tunnel: add javadoc supportJason A. Donenfeld2020-03-114-11/+26
* tunnel: the external API does not expose java9Jason A. Donenfeld2020-03-101-2/+2
* tunnel: tools: update to latest goJason A. Donenfeld2020-03-102-29/+29
* tunnel: make use of @RestrictToJason A. Donenfeld2020-03-102-0/+7
* build: abstract out groupNameJason A. Donenfeld2020-03-102-4/+4
* global: java access control has important semantic meaningJason A. Donenfeld2020-03-103-3/+3
* tunnel: Codestyle cleanupsHarsh Shandilya2020-03-106-37/+33
* ui: Codestyle cleanupsHarsh Shandilya2020-03-101-3/+3
* tunnel: upload aar to bintrayJason A. Donenfeld2020-03-102-0/+67
* build: apply version to both modulesJason A. Donenfeld2020-03-091-2/+2
* Version bumpJason A. Donenfeld2020-03-091-0/+0
* global: format codeJason A. Donenfeld2020-03-0911-184/+195
* global: optimize importsJason A. Donenfeld2020-03-0915-44/+29
* global: get rid of nonnull gradle hackJason A. Donenfeld2020-03-0925-1/+70